Code

Rating   Name Duplication Size Complexity CRAP Changes Bugs Features
C OrientatedItemFactory::getBestOrientation() 0 32 12 12 0 0 0
B BoxPacker\VolumePacker::packLayer() 0 41 9 9 0 0 0
B WeightRedistributor::equaliseWeight() 0 30 8 8.9 0 0 0
B WeightRedistributor::redistributeWeight() 0 20 7 7 0 0 0
B OrientatedItemFactory::getUsableOrientations() 0 13 7 7.6 0 0 0
A BoxPacker\Packer::doVolumePacking() 0 16 6 6 0 0 0
A OrientatedItemFactory::getPossibleOrientations() 0 14 6 6 0 0 0
A OrientatedItemFactory::getPossibleOrientationsInEmptyBox() 0 24 3 3 0 0 0
A VolumePacker::tryAndStackItemsIntoSpace() 0 18 4 4 0 0 0
A OrientatedItemFactory::calculateAdditionalItemsPackedWithThisOrientation() 0 15 3 3 0 0 0
A BoxPacker\LayerStabiliser::stabilise() 0 13 3 3 0 0 0
A VolumePacker::getOrientationForItem() 0 12 2 2 0 0 0
A DVDoug\BoxPacker\VolumePacker::pack() 0 9 3 3 0 0 0
A DVDoug\BoxPacker\ItemList::compare() 0 9 3 3 0 0 0
A BoxPacker\VolumePacker::__construct() 0 9 3 3 0 0 0